Iceland parliamentary elections pluralistic and transparent, says OSCE/ODIHR final report, recommends measures to strengthen legal framework

The 27 April 2013 parliamentary elections in Iceland were conducted in a pluralistic and transparent manner, but certain aspects of the electoral legal framework could benefit from further review, the OSCE Office for Democratic Institutions and Human Rights (ODIHR) says in its final report, which was released on 24 June 2013...

ERGNETI, 21 June 2013- The 35th meeting under the Incident Prevention and Response Mechanism (IPRM) took place in Ergneti today, co-facilitated by the OSCE and EU Monitoring Mission (EUMM)...

TIRANA, 21 June 2013 (shqip) – The Special Co-ordinator and leader of the short-term OSCE election observer mission, and the Heads of the Parliamentary delegations of the OSCE and the Council of Europe observing the 23 June parliamentary elections in Albania, call on all political leaders to use the remaining days to engage in a constructive process to ensure that the elections can proceed unhindered.
